| The 5-Minute Pediatric Consult is the
newly-revised, best-selling reference providing immediate, practical advice
on problems seen in infants, children, and adolescents. More than 450
diseases are covered in the fast-access format that makes The 5-Minute
Consult Series so popular among busy clinicians.
With Unbound Medicine's award-winning design, you can choose from multiple
indexes to instantly navigate to the information that best answers your
clinical questions. Start with the basics by choosing a symptom, then
move on to review differential diagnosis, treatment options, follow-up
care and more.
